Enhancing Accuracy in Food Security Services: Challenges and Technological Solutions

This research is significant because the accuracy of public services in the field of food security directly influences food availability and community welfare in Maluku Province. The study aims to examine the precision and effectiveness of public services delivered by the Maluku Provincial Food Security Agency in implementing market operations. A descriptive qualitative method was employed, utilizing interviews, observations, and document analysis as data collection techniques. The findings indicate that, despite facing challenges such as limited technological infrastructure and coordination barriers, the agency has demonstrated effectiveness in executing market operations. The study concludes that enhancing the use of technology and strengthening collaboration among stakeholders are crucial steps toward improving the accuracy and reliability of public services in the region's food security sector.
